首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从另一个Select结果中选择mysql和php

从另一个SELECT结果中选择MySQL和PHP可以通过使用子查询来实现。子查询是将一个SELECT语句嵌套在另一个SELECT语句中的查询。

以下是一个示例查询,演示如何从另一个SELECT结果中选择MySQL和PHP:

代码语言:txt
复制
SELECT language
FROM (
    SELECT language
    FROM programming_languages
    WHERE language IN ('MySQL', 'PHP')
) AS subquery;

在上面的示例中,我们首先在子查询中选择了语言为MySQL和PHP的记录,然后将子查询作为一个临时表(使用AS关键字指定别名为subquery)进行查询,最终返回了MySQL和PHP。

在这个例子中,我们假设存在一个名为programming_languages的表,其中包含了编程语言的信息。你可以根据实际情况替换表名和字段名。

对于这个问题,腾讯云提供了多个与MySQL和PHP相关的产品和服务:

  1. 云数据库MySQL:腾讯云提供的一种高性能、可扩展的关系型数据库服务,适用于各种规模的应用程序。它提供了自动备份、容灾、监控等功能,可以满足各种业务需求。了解更多:云数据库MySQL
  2. 云服务器(CVM):腾讯云提供的弹性计算服务,可以轻松部署和管理云上的应用程序。你可以在云服务器上安装和运行MySQL和PHP,并进行开发和测试。了解更多:云服务器
  3. 云函数(SCF):腾讯云提供的事件驱动的无服务器计算服务,可以帮助你构建和运行无需管理服务器的应用程序。你可以使用云函数来执行与MySQL和PHP相关的任务,如数据处理、定时任务等。了解更多:云函数

请注意,以上仅是腾讯云提供的一些与MySQL和PHP相关的产品和服务,你可以根据具体需求选择适合的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MySQL如何选择VARCHARCHAR类型

首先,VARCHARCHAR是两种最主要的字符串类型。...在设计用于存储字符串的表字段时,可能会对到底选哪个类型有所犹豫,确实如果不了解它们之间的区别,选择上不会那么容易,本篇将详细介绍它们之间的区别以及如何正确的选择恰当的类型。...对于字符串数据如何存储在磁盘内存,不同存储引擎具体的实现也不同,所以,接下来的内容仅限于InnoDB存储引擎。 区别 下面用一张图来展示VARCHARCHAR之间的区别。 ?...选型 同样用一张图来展示如何选择VARCHARCHAR存储字符串。 ?...小结 对存储字符串选型来说,可以根据上面指出的原则来进行选择,但有一点是一样的,那就是只给与真正需要的空间,因为更长的列会消耗更多的内存。 END 如果觉得有收获,记得关注、点赞、转发。

1.8K60

如何在 Python 执行 MySQL 结果限制分页查询

Python MySQL 限制结果 限制结果数量 示例 1: 获取您自己的 Python 服务器 选择 "customers" 表的前 5 条记录: import mysql.connector mydb...() for x in myresult: print(x) 另一个位置开始 如果您想返回第三条记录开始的五条记录,可以使用 "OFFSET" 关键字: 示例 2: 位置 3 开始,返回 5...="yourpassword", database="mydatabase" ) # 创建游标对象 mycursor = mydb.cursor() # 使用INNER JOIN合并用户产品表格...) # 打印结果 for x in myresult: print(x) 注意:您可以使用JOIN代替INNER JOIN,它们都会给您相同的结果。...LEFT JOIN 在上面的示例,Hannah Michael 被排除在结果之外,因为INNER JOIN仅显示存在匹配的记录。

23520

MySqlvarcharchar,如何选择合适的数据类型?

背景 学过MySQL的同学都知道MySQLvarcharchar是两种最主要的字符串类型,varchar是变长的类型,而char是固定长度。...那关于如何选择类型就成为令人头疼的事,很多初学者为了保证业务兼容性强,存储字符串类型一律都是varchar类型。这是不妥的,需要根据varcharchar的特性来进行选择。...varcharchar数据类型的区别 varchar类型用于存储可变长的字符串,是比较常见常用的字符串数据类型,在存储的字符串是变长时,varchar更加节约空间。...在存储数据时,MySQL会删除所有文末的空格,所以,即便你存储的是:'abc ',注意这个字符串末尾是有空格的,也会在存储时把这个空格删掉,这点需要注意。...到2个字节存储长度信息 update语句可能会导致页分裂 char的优点: 定长的字符串类型,减少内存碎片 无需额外的内存空间去存储长度信息 char的缺点: 会删除列末尾的空格信息 参考: 《高性能MySQL

2.3K20

MysqlCHARVARCHAR如何选择?给定的长度到底是用来干什么的?

于是又讨论到了varchar在MySQL的存储方式。,以证明增加长度所占用的空间并不大。那么我们就看看varchar在mysql到底是如何存储的。 ?...varchar类型在mysql如何定义的? 先看看官方文档: ? ?...ALL IN ALL 在MySQL数据库,用的最多的字符型数据类型就是VarcharChar.。这两种数据类型虽然都是用来存放字符型数据,但是无论结构还是数据的保存方式来看,两者相差很大。...结果是否定的。虽然他们用来存储90个字符的数据,其存储空间相同。但是对于内存的消耗是不同的。...还是要评估实际需要的长度,然后选择一个最长的字段来设置字符长度。如果为了考虑冗余,可以留10%左右的字符长度。

3.4K40

PHP全栈学习笔记23

将字符串写入指定的文件 file 读取某文件的内容,并将结果保存到数组,数组内每个元素的内容对应读取文件的一行 filetype 返回文件类型 fopen打开某文件 fread文件指针所指文件读取指定长度的数据...mysql_fetch_array 结果集中获取一行作为关联数组,或数字数组 mysql_fetch_assoc 结果集中获取一行作为关联数组 mysql_fetch_field 结果集中获取列信息并作为对象返回...mysql_fetch_object 结果集中获取一行作为对象 mysql_fetch_row 结果集中获取一行作为枚举数组 mysql_num_rows 获取结果集中行的数目 mysql_query...发送一条sql查询 mysql_select_db 选择数据库 <?...检索字符串 strstr()函数substr_count()函数 strstr()函数获取一个指定字符串在另一个字符串首次出现的位置到后者末尾的子字符串。

3.7K30

米斯特白帽培训讲义(v2)漏洞篇 SQL 注入

关于数据库环境我想说一下,不同数据库使用不同的配置 SQL 方言,一个数据库上有用的方法不一定能用在另一个数据库上。但是,目前 70% 的网站都使用 MySQL,所以这篇讲义只会涉及 MySQL。...判断列数量 我们下一步需要判断查询结果的列数量,以便之后使用union语句。我们构造: id=1 order by ? 其中问号处替换为 1 开始的数字,一个一个尝试它们。...查询表的数量 MySQL 中有一个数据库叫做information_schema,储存数据库表的元信息。...,1 同样,我们需要把问号替换为 0 1; ? 我们这里查询结果为,第一列叫做userid,第二列叫做email。...之后开始爆破(类型选择cluster bomb,第一个 payload 选择number,第二个 payload 选择preset lists): ? 我们通过查表得知,结果为test。

2.3K70

The Clean Architecture in PHP 读书笔记(一)

本书的目的是解决如何构建一个中大型应用,并且满足: 可测性 可重构 易处理 易维护 而对小的应用,不适合本书的原则,本书在组织上按照: 先介绍平时写PHP代码遇到的共性问题,然后给出为什么good, solid...框架的选择上也非常有讲究,每年都有新的框架产生、消亡,我们要选择那些文档好的,活力好的框架,并且框架不应该限制的应用太死,这样我们的应用能快速的从一个框架切换到另一个框架。...php $results = mysql_query( 'SELECT * FROM customers ORDER BY name' ); ?...应用主要有两个关注点:一个是数据库获取数据,另一个是是对数据进行展示。 重构的噩梦 考虑下面的变更 表名(customers)或者列名(name)变了怎么办?有多少文件你需要去修改?...如果我们要从mysql_换到PDO怎么办?如果数据不再是数据库,而是Restful API? 如果我们开始使用模块语言,如Twig或者Blade?

42730

PHP】一文详解如何连接Mysql数据库(附源码)

连接准备   下面将对PHP连接Mysql数据库的一些数据库参数函数做一个介绍:  数据库参数介绍   PHP连接数据库我们需要待连接数据库的数据库名、用户名密码 在本文中,对待连接的数据库做出以下名称假设...: 数据库名:database_name 用户名:  user_name 密码:  password  PHP函数介绍   在PHP连接Mysql数据库并且将数据查询打印出来主要用到了以下函数...mysqli_fetch_assoc() 结果集中取得一行作为关联数组   mysqli_connect() mysqli_connect(host,username,password,dbname...---- 前端界面   为了从简,本文教程基于一个最基本的前端界面,只有两个输入框一个提交按钮 PS:前端界面需要使用.php后缀,也就是说前端界面代码要放入一个php文件!..."); mysqli_select_db($con,"database_name") or die("数据库选择失败!

1.1K10

【译】现代化的PHP开发--PDO

它是在PHP 2.0.0引入的,但是PHP 5.5.0开始就被弃用了,并且已经在PHP7.0.0被剔除了。考虑到在较新的PHP 版本不支持此扩展,因此不建议使用此扩展。...1.2、MySQLi: PHP 5.0.0开始,mysql扩展的一个改进版本mysqli被引入。...在下面的小节,我们将从使用PDO运行查询的一些常见方法开始。然后我们将演示如何使用PDO执行各种MySQL 数据操作语句。最后,我们将重点介绍几个PDO APIs,它们的用途相同,但方式不同。...PHP_EOL; } PDOStatement::fetchColumn可以选择接受单个参数(列名)。该参数是指定从中检索数据的列0开始的索引编号。当该参数被省略时,它默认为列编号0。...这两个代码是相同的,除了一个是使用$statement->bindParam,另一个是使用$statement->bindValue。但他们结果完全不同。

1.9K00

这15道PHP面试题足够展示你的能力了(带有答案)

如果用在包含文件,则返回包含文件名。自 PHP 4.0.2 起,__FILE__ 总是包含一个绝对路径,而在此之前的版本有时会包含一个相对路径。 2、如何获取客户端的IP地址?...unserialize — 已存储的表示创建 PHP 的值 具体用法: $arr = array(“测试1″,”测试2″,”测试3″);//数组 $sarr = serialize($arr);//...($newarr);//已存储的表示创建 PHP 的值 10、写出一个函数,参数为年份月份,输出结果为指定月的天数(5分) Function day_count($year,$month){ Echo...数据库db_test里已建有表friend,数据库的连接用户为root,密码为123 friend表字段为:id,name,age,gender,phone,email 请使用php连接mysql选择出...; Mysql_select_db(“db_test”,$link) or die(“选择数据库失败!”)

91610

PHP升级到5.5+后MySQL函数及其Mysqli函数代替用法

取得 mysql_list_dbs() 调用所返回的数据库名 mysql_db_query — (mysqli_select_db() then the mysqli_query())选择一个数据库并在它上面执行一个查询... PHP 5.3.0 起弃用 用 mysql_select_db() mysql_query() 代替 mysql_drop_db — (Execute a DROP DATABASE query...结果取得指定字段关联的标志 mysql_field_len — (mysqli_fetch_field_direct() [length])返回指定字段的长度 mysql_field_name —... PHP 5.3.0 起弃用 用 mysql_select_db() mysql_query() 代替 mysql_drop_db — (Execute a DROP DATABASE query...结果取得指定字段关联的标志 mysql_field_len — (mysqli_fetch_field_direct() [length])返回指定字段的长度 mysql_field_name —

1K20

PHP中使用MySQL Mysqli操作数据库 ,以及类操作方法

>      在上例,如mysql_connect()执行失败,将显示系统的错误提示,而后继续往下执行。那,该如何屏蔽这些系统的错误提示并在失败后结束程序?  ...>      mysql_db_query()与mysql_query()的区别就在于前者可以不用使用mysql_select_db()来选择数据库database,而在执行SQL语句的同时,进行选择数据库...获取数据 网页程序大多数工作都是在获取格式化所请求的数据。为此,要向数据库发送 SELECT查询,再对结果进行迭代处理,将各行输出给浏览器,并按照自己的要求输出。...确定所选择的行受影响的行 通常希望能够确定 SELECT查询返回的行数 , 或者受 INSERT 、 UPDATE 或 DELET 查询 影响的行数。...$fetchRow && $Rows){$this->Rows++;} return $fetchRow; } function fieldFlags($fieldOffset){ /* 结果取得指定字段关联的标志

4.1K30

PHP全栈学习笔记5

PHP全栈学习笔记5 phpmysql数据库,PHP支持很多数据库,与mysql为牛逼组合,mysql数据库的基础知识的掌握是由必要的,要了解如何操作mysql数据库,数据表的方法。...image.png php操作数据库 mysql_connect()函数连接mysql服务器 mysql_select_db()函数选择数据库 mysql_query()函数执行sql语句 mysql_fetch_array...()函数数组结果集中获取信息 mysql_fetch_row()函数逐行获取结果集中的每条记录 mysql_num_rows()函数获取查询结果集中的记录数 insert动态添加 select...); } mysql_fetch_array()函数数组结果集中获取信息: array mysql_fetch_array ( resource result [, int result_type]...) mysql_fetch_object()函数结果集中获取一行作为对象 object mysql_fetch_object ( resource result ) 对象 <?

1.5K20

面试题(三)

优化MYSQL数据库的方法 选择最有效率的表名顺序 WHERE子句中的连接顺序 SELECT子句中避免使用‘*’ 用Where子句替换HAVING子句 通过内部函数提高SQL效率 避免在索引列上使用计算...使用事务外键 MySQL主从备份的原理?...mysql支持单向、异步复制,复制过程中一个服务器充当主服务器,而一个或多个其它服务器充当服务器。 error_reporting() 的作用? 设置 PHP 的报错级别并返回当前级别。...如何修改session的生存时间 在php.ini 设置 session.gc_maxlifetime = 1440 //默认时间 代码实现 <?...有两点一定要记住: 对用户会话采用适当的安全措施,例如:给每一个会话更新id用户使用SSL。生成另一个一次性的令牌并将其嵌入表单,保存在会话(一个会话变量),在提交时检查它。

2.4K10
领券